2.2.3 Step 3 — Connect Power
When all other connections have been made, you can connect power to the Prototyping
Board.
First, prepare the AC adapter for the country where it will be used by selecting the plug.
The RCM3909/RCM3319 Development Kit presently includes Canada/Japan/U.S., Aus-
tralia/N.Z., U.K., and European style plugs. Snap in the top of the plug assembly into the
slot at the top of the AC adapter as shown in Figure 3, then press down on the spring-
loaded clip below the plug assembly to allow the plug assembly to click into place.
Connect the AC adapter to 3-pin header J2 on the Prototyping Board as shown in Figure 3.
Plug in the AC adapter.
RCM3309/RCM3319 and the Prototyping Board are now ready to be used.
NOTE: A RESET button is provided on the Prototyping Board to allow a hardware reset
without disconnecting power.
